Grevensmolen - Vegelingsoord

N 53.0167065 / E 5.8568893

This mill, a polder mill, was originally built to drain the surrounding land and played a crucial role in managing the Frisian water landscape. Over the years, the Grevensmolen has always remained grinding capable and contributes to the preservation of traditional Dutch mill culture.

The lacy mill, type ground-sailer, with living quarters, was built in 1860 and rigorously refurbished in 2006. This restoration involved restoring and reusing as much historical material as possible. The mill was given a completely new thatched roof and the old 1860 reed slats were used. The mill is open to the public by appointment.
